Scotland will shortly be free to raise debt under it's own name. But it may well come at a price. Though Scotland votes in September on the chance to break its union with England - there is huge anxiety on it being denied the pound, as George Osborne insists - a new concession allows Scotland to issue more than £2bn in bonds.
